Description
Specialist Employability Support (SES) is a new national provision, designed to help unemployed disabled adults to secure and sustain employment or self-employment. The programme focuses on helping those furthest away from the employment market, and for whom other provision is not suitable and offers an individually tailored combination of guidance, work placements, and work experience. This new provision features two main support options: • Specialist Employability Support (SES) - intensive, end-to-end employment provision (up to 2 years), and; • SES Start Back - a shorter-term provision (approximately 8 weeks) that works with disabled people to help them to prepare for other provision (DWP or non-DWP), where appropriate.
